Transaction 5702df2eb24c1942ef71420660e3bdefc8e9f8e8a59bd93ea302e43c3271069b
3 Input
2 Outputs
- 5702df2eb24c1942ef71420660e3bdefc8e9f8e8a59bd93ea302e43c3271069b:0
- 5702df2eb24c1942ef71420660e3bdefc8e9f8e8a59bd93ea302e43c3271069b:1
value 16298929
address 1Eg52q97SEqoQBKegEfntnZGUPJJTLnzAS
value 40000000
address 33vr781xziYpV8mZMGVwP4mprT9rVjP1SD